Transaction 73667b54012e906f8a00c6588d6e60eba342a29bea93b0b60d11301432b6749e

1 Input
2 Outputs
  • 73667b54012e906f8a00c6588d6e60eba342a29bea93b0b60d11301432b6749e:0
  • value  743300692
    address  3HUhwkZq5rfWtNvAXMUaFU3PMoc5Qnb7nQ
  • 73667b54012e906f8a00c6588d6e60eba342a29bea93b0b60d11301432b6749e:1
  • value  1076168607
    address  15LjPHtVMhr5kaRgA9APdFv3HHMehhbLVx